Comparative Analysis of Different Numerical Methods for the Solution of Initial Value Problems in First Order Ordinary Differential Equations

A mathematical equation which involves a function and its derivatives is called a differential equation. We consider a real life situation, from this form a mathematical model, solve that model using some mathematical concepts and take interpretation of solution. It is a well known and popular concept in mathematics because of its massive application in real world problems. Differential equations are one of the most important mathematical tools used in modeling problems in Physics, Biology, Economics, Chemistry, Engineering and medical Sciences. Differential equation can describe many situations viz exponential growth and de cay, the population growth of species, the change in investment return over time. We can solve differential equations using classical as well as numerical methods, In this paper we compare numerical methods of solving initial valued first order ordinary differential equations namely Euler method, Improved Euler method, Runge Kutta method and their accuracy level. We use here Scilab Software to obtain direct solution for these methods.

RP 165 Solving Some Special Classes of Standard Cubic Congruence of Composite Modulus

In this paper, a special class of standard cubic congruence of composite modulus is studied and formulated the solutions. The discussion is presented here. This cubic congruence has three types of solutions. In first case, it has exactly 3 incongruent solutions in second case, it has nine incongruent solutions and in third case it has twenty seven incongruent solutions. First time a suitable formulation is available for a class of standard cubic congruence. So, formulation is the merit of the paper.

Application of Arithmetic Progression in Equilateral Triangle as Mathematics Brain Teaser

In a classroom situation generally homogeneous teaching goes for heterogeneous groups of students. Mathematically gifted students always require some differentiated instruction from those of other students because they demonstrate an uneven pattern of mathematical understanding and development. Though they are endowed with high computation skills, problem solving strategies, inferential thinking skills, or deductive reasoning and are often able to discern answers with unusual speed and accuracy even smart enough in finding the inter relationships among and between ideas, topics, and concepts without the intervention of formal instruction specifically geared to that particular content, yet several factors never allow them to nourish their creativity as teachers are overloaded, non friendly mathematics curriculum, sometimes lack of parental support. To address this issue a mathematical brain teaser typically designed to stimulate cognitive processes and involves lateral logical thinking of those gifted students in order to solve the teaser for amusement even. Actually in a specially designed equilateral triangle Several equal number of intra parallel lines from each side of triangle with same distance between the parallels produces many triangles, parallelograms, trapeziums, rhombus, and regular hexagons. Gifted students may count those Geometrical figures faster than the others and those answers can be justified by using formulas developed by me. Those formulas are developed with the help of simple concept of arithmetic progression. It would help to develop and improve cognitive functions via logical reasoning of those gifted students.

Learning of Advanced Mathematics by Chinese Liberal Arts Students A Study of Developing Applied Mathematical Ability

According to statistics, more than 90 of Chinese universities have offered advanced mathematics for liberal arts students as a general course since 2003 to cultivate their scientific literacy and problem solving ability. This study aims to provide a feasible approach for liberal arts students to accept the value of mathematics and apply mathematical methods to academic research and real world problems solution. In the Applied Probability and Statistics class with the attendance of 154 liberal arts freshmen, this study is designed to discuss and value on the five mathematics application reports as examples. Then liberal arts students were interviewed on evaluating these 5 mathematics application reports. 28 mathematics application reports were completed by 154 students in groups and cooperation, which were analyzed on how mathematics was incorporated into their reports. The qualitative analysis of the interview results found that the discussion and evaluation of these 5 mathematics application reports about applying mathematics and solving social problems can stimulate liberal arts students' interest in mathematics and realize the value of mathematics application. Therefore, peer mathematics application is a way for liberal arts students to realize mathematics value. Through the classification analysis of the 28 mathematics application reports completed by the liberal arts students, their three forms of mathematics application can be summarized as follows applying the regularity of mathematical argument instead of the special case of the practice test in social cognition using data analysis to monitor the probabilities of plausible reasoning developing their applied mathematical ability to solve daily life problems.

The Super Stability of Third Order Linear Ordinary Differential Homogeneous Equation with Boundary Condition

The stability problem is a fundamental issue in the design of any distributed systems like local area networks, multiprocessor systems, distribution computation and multidimensional queuing systems. In Mathematics stability theory addresses the stability solutions of differential, integral and other equations, and trajectories of dynamical systems under small perturbations of initial conditions. Differential equations describe many mathematical models of a great interest in Economics, Control theory, Engineering, Biology, Physics and to many areas of interest. In this study the recent work of Jinghao Huang, Qusuay. H. Alqifiary, and Yongjin Li in establishing the super stability of differential equation of second order with boundary condition was extended to establish the super stability of differential equation third order with boundary condition.

Applications of Wavelet Transform

Wavelets are mathematical functions. The wavelet transform is a tool that cuts up data, functions or operators into different frequency components and then studies each component with a resolution matched to its scale. It is needed, because analyzing discontinuities and sharp spikes of the signal and applications as image compression, human vision, radar, and earthquake prediction.
